The board approved FY26 consolidated audited results showing revenue of Rs 2,653.89 Cr (down 43% from Rs 4,612.22 Cr in FY25) due to lower fair value gains on investments. Standalone PAT surged to Rs 1,929.35 Cr vs Rs 126.36 Cr in FY25, boosted by net gain of Rs 964.45 Cr on financial instruments at fair value and a Rs 94.64 Cr bargain purchase gain. However, consolidated PAT turned negative at Rs -1,985.12 Cr vs +Rs 4,241.41 Cr, mainly due to negative OCI of Rs -2,289.13 Cr from fair value losses on equity instruments. The board also approved amendments to the Memorandum of Association, aligning the objects clause with current business operations without changing the main objects. Shareholder approval via postal ballot is being sought.
Revenue decline reflects reduced fair value gains rather than operational deterioration. Standalone profitability is strong but consolidated losses and negative OCI indicate significant mark-to-market losses on equity investments. MOA amendments are routine housekeeping with no strategic change.
